I have a FA daughter, but it's a friend who needs help and she has asked for my advice.

She thinks her son, who is almost 5, has a nitrate intolerance, or something. The way he explains his symptoms is about 6 hours after he has eaten a food with nitrates, he starts vomiting, and vomits on and off for about 36 hours. Then he feels very weak for another day and then is fine. No fever, diarrhea, and the rest of the family is fine. So probably not food poisoning or a virus as she first thought. She is getting an appointment with her pediatrician and a 'specialist' though I'm not sure what kind of specialist.

Of course she's stopped giving him the food with nitrates.

If any one has any ideas, I'll pass them along. I don't feel like much of a help because it doesn't sound like an allergy specifically. And my experience is based mostly on testing and then avoidance.
